Clinical Observations on the Treatment of Pseudobulbar Paralysis by Combined Scalp and Body Acupuncture / 针灸推拿医学(英文版)
Journal of Acupuncture and Tuina Science ; (6): 153-155, 2006.

ABSTRACT

Objective:

To investigate the efficacy of scalp acupuncture in combination with body acupuncture for treating pseudobulbar paralysis.

Methods:

Eighty patients were randomly divided into treatment and control groups, 40 cases each. The control group was treated by the routine method of Western medicine and the treatment group by combined scalp and body acupuncture on the basis of the former. The curative effect was evaluated after treatment in both groups. The influence of the treatment on mean blood velocity(MBV) in anterior, middle and posterior cerebral arteries was observed by transcranial Doppler(TCD) in both groups.

Results:

The total efficacy rate was 97.5% in the treatment group and 12.5% in the control group. The recovery rate was 75% in the treatment group and 0% in the control group. There was a significant difference between the two groups(P< 0. 01). TCD showed that blood velocity in cerebral arteries was significantly increased and the unbalanced stasis of the right and left cerebral blood flow changed in the treatment group. A comparison of MBV between pretreatment and posttreatment showed P < 0.01.

Conclusion:

Scalp acupuncture in combination with body acupuncture has a good effect on pseudobulbar paralysis.
